Abstract
dc.description.abstract
A simple and sensitive kinetic spectrophotometric method was developed for the determination of ciclopirox olamine in pharmaceutical formulations (cream). The method is based on the oxidation of ciclopirox olamine with KMnO4 in alkaline medium to form K2MnO4, a bluish green color compound, at ionic strength controlled and room temperature. The reaction is monitored measuring the rate of change of absorbance at 610 nm. The absorbance-concentration plot corresponding to synthetic pharmaceutical samples (cream) was rectilinear, over the range of 0.32 - 10.0 mu g mL(-1), with detection and quantification limits of 0.095 mu g mL(-1) and 0.32 mu g mL(-1), respectively. Different experimental parameters affecting the development and stability of the reaction product were carefully studied via factorial screening and optimized by univariate method. The determination of ciclopirox olamine by the fixed time method is feasible and more advantageous with the calibration equation obtained at 30 min. The proposed method was validated for the application of the determination of the drug in pharmaceutical sample (cream)
